Ferrari enjoyed its best day of 2025 so far, as Charles Leclerc topped both practice sessions on the opening day of the Monaco Grand Prix. Lewis Hamilton was third-quickest as Oscar Piastri found himself in a Ferrari sandwich, whilst Max Verstappen was down in P10. It was another bad Friday for Red Bull, but also for Mercedes. Despite topping both Friday practice sessions, Ferrari driver Charles Leclerc believes it’s “too early to feel positive” about a strong result at the Monaco Grand Prix. Initially facing a scare when he clipped Lance Stroll’s Aston Martin in FP1, Leclerc improved his pace throughout the day, setting the fastest lap times in both sessions. Leclerc cautiously acknowledged the positive performance but remained reserved about Ferrari’s overall chances for the weekend.
